网站建设,网站制作,网站建设公司,网页设计公司

滚动网页怎么做?实用的技巧有哪些

在网页设计中,滚动网页是常见的页面设计方式之一。滚动网页可以让用户在同一页面内浏览更多的内容,也可以使网页看起来更加简洁大方,因此被广泛应用在各种网页设计中。那么,滚动网页怎么做?实用的技巧有哪些?一起来看看吧。

滚动网页怎么做?

一、通过CSS实现滚动网页

通过CSS制作滚动网页是最简单的方法之一。为了让网页实现滚动效果,可以将页面的高度设置为一个固定的像素值,并使用overflow属性将其隐藏,然后使用一个包含滚动条的容器来包裹页面内容。具体实现步骤如下:
滚动网页怎么做?实用的技巧有哪些
1. 在CSS中设置页面高度:

```css
html, body {
  height: 100%;
}
body {
  margin: 0;
  padding: 0;
}
.wrapper {
  height: 100%;
  overflow: hidden;
}
```

2. 在HTML中插入包含滚动条的div容器:

```html
<div class="wrapper">
  <div class="content">
    ...
  </div>
</div>
```

3. 在CSS中设置滚动条的样式:

```css
.wrapper {
  overflow-y: scroll;
  scrollbar-width: thin;
  scrollbar-color: #8e9191 #ccc;
}
.wrapper::-webkit-scrollbar {
  width: 6px;
}
.wrapper::-webkit-scrollbar-thumb {
  background-color: #8e9191;
}
.wrapper::-webkit-scrollbar-track {
  background-color: #ccc;
}
```

二、使用jQuery实现滚动网页

虽然通过CSS实现滚动效果是一种简单直接的方法,但是如果想要实现更加复杂、灵活的操作,可以使用jQuery。jQuery内置了许多滚动相关的方法,可以方便地进行页面滚动操作,如scrollTop()和scrollLeft()。具体实现步骤如下:

1. 在HTML中插入容器:

```html
<div id="wrapper">
  <div id="content">
    ...
  </div>
</div>
```

2. 使用jQuery获取容器,并添加滚动监听事件:

```javascript
$(document).ready(function () {
  $("#wrapper").on("scroll", function () {
    var scrollTop = $(this).scrollTop();
    console.log(scrollTop);
    // do something...
  });
});
```

3. 在回调函数中对滚动事件进行处理:

```javascript
$(document).ready(function () {
  $("#wrapper").on("scroll", function () {
    var scrollTop = $(this).scrollTop();
    // change the style of page elements
    if (scrollTop > 100) {
      $("#header").addClass("sticky");
    } else {
      $("#header").removeClass("sticky");
    }
  });
});
```

本文链接:https://www.taodigood.com/jianwangzhan/11576.html

版权声明:本站部分文章来自网络转载,不以盈利为目的,只为分享知识使用,如涉及侵权请告知,核实后立即删除!

相关推荐

  • 移动端的网页怎么做?怎么设计

    移动端的网页被广泛应用于手机、平板等移动设备上,因此,对于设计移动端网页的开发者而言,需考虑到不同设备尺寸、浏览器厂商的特性,以及响应式设计等因素,那么移动端的网页怎么做?怎么设计?一起来看看吧。...

  • 如何制作网页最简单的方法是什么?做

    关于说到网页制作是一门基础的技能,学习HTML和CSS语言可以帮助你理解网页的结构和样式设置。当你掌握了这些技能,便可以开始创意性地构建各种不同类型的网站,需要掌握基本的HTML和CSS知识。...

  • 单网页怎么做?用什么方法进行实现

    单网页(Single Page Application)是一种Web应用程序的设计方法,其基本思想是将所有的功能都集中在同一个页面中,通过JavaScript等技术实现页面部分的动态更新,用户无需每次进行完整的页面刷新。与传统多页面应用相比,单网页应用具有更好的用户体验和性能优势,已经被广泛应用于Web开发领域。...

  • 动态网页怎么做?制作动态网页的步

    动态网页是指其内容根据用户请求生成的网页,而不是像静态网页那样的预先编排好的内容。动态网页的内容通常是从数据库或其他数据源中读取的,网页中的内容和数据可以随时更新,因此它可以产生更多更富有交互性的内容来满足用户需求。那么动态网页怎么做?制作动态网页的步骤有哪些?一起来看看吧。...

  • 如何生成静态网站页面?应该怎么做

    现如今说到如果做网站,你只是想要一个简单的静态网站,不想涉及到太多的技术细节,那么如何生成静态网站页面?应该怎么做?关于这个问题就一起来看看。...

  • 自己创建网页怎么做?要做好哪些准备

    现如今说到制作网站,新人在选择专业网站开发工具或者网站制作服务时,那么自己创建网页怎么做?要做好哪些准备呢?关于这个问题就一起来看看吧。...

联系客服
网站客服 业务合作 QQ号
3227292445
微信号
微信号
微信二维码
返回顶部